Begin your day with a visit to the Citadel of Salah al-Din, a historic fortress offering panoramic views of Cairo. Learn about the significance of the Citadel, which was once the seat of Egypt’s rulers. Within the Citadel, you’ll explore the stunning Mosque of Muhammad Ali (also known as the Alabaster Mosque), famous for its impressive Ottoman architecture and magnificent dome.
Next, head to the Hanging Church (Saint Sergius and Bacchus), one of the oldest and most important Christian sites in Egypt. Located in Coptic Cairo, this unique church dates back to the 3rd century and is renowned for its fascinating architecture and rich history.

In the afternoon, experience the lively atmosphere of Khan El Khalili Bazaar, one of Cairo’s oldest and most famous markets. Wander through the narrow alleys filled with vendors selling spices, jewelry, textiles, and traditional Egyptian souvenirs. This bustling market offers a glimpse into Cairo’s vibrant culture and is the perfect place to pick up unique gifts and treasures.
